9There are three main shows in the Find The Path repertoire. Each one covers an adventure path published for TabletopGame/{{Pathfinder}} by Paizo Inc.
10
11* ''Mummy's Mask'' (The adventure begins in the city of Wati, where a lottery is being held for explorers who want to investigate the Necropolis. A criminal-turned-monk, a black marketeer, a priest of Horus, and a painter join together as the Doorkeepers of the Duat to see what secrets the Half Dead City holds for them. Can the Doorkeepers uncover the mysteries of the Necropolis and save not just Wati, but all of Osirion?)
12
13* ''Hell's Rebels'' (Five everyday people find themselves pulled into a rebellion when the Lord Mayor of Kintargo incites a riot. The adventure begins in the shining city of Kintargo where a glassblower, a university professor, a choreographer, a union rep, and a novice P.I. are going about their normal lives before the protest the following morning. When they all attend the protest, what starts as a peaceful gathering, soon unravels into violence. Now they must get away without getting caught and find out how they might become the key to the future of the city itself!)
14
15* ''Tyrant's Grasp'' (Patron Exclusive: The adventure begins in the small town of Roslar’s Coffer where a woodworker, a barmaid, a rancher, and a cemetery caretaker are preparing for the yearly Remembrance Moon festival celebrating lives lost defending Lastwall. Just as the festivities begin, our heroes see a flash of light and awaken entombed in a crypt. Now they must figure out a way to get home before all is lost!)

17The cast members include:
18
19* Rick Sandidge (Gamemaster for all three main shows)
20* Heather Allen (Onuris and [[spoiler:Masika]] in Mummy's Mask, Cesare in Hell's Rebels, and Valorae in Tyrant's Grasp)
21* Jessica Jenkins (Sagira and [[spoiler:Hollis]] in Mummy's Mask, Adria in Hell's Rebels, Ailsa and [[spoiler:Cypress]] in Tyrant's Grasp)
22* Jordan Jenkins (Sudi in Mummy's Mask, Lucia in Hell's Rebels, and Octavius in Tyrant's Grasp)
23* Rachel Sandidge (Sitra in Mummy's Mask, Vittoria in Hell's Rebels, and Darcy in Tyrant's Grasp)
24* Ross Scoggin (Niccolo in Hell's Rebels and Rosemund in Tyrant's Grasp)
